AbstractCurrent IoT communication node spacing selection process show may potential areas for improvements such as high delay ratio, high total energy consumption ratio, confusion of the optimal communication information band, intelligent spacing node design under the constraints of the energy-saving selection of IoT communication. Based on energy-saving constraints, the link status between nodes is evaluated through link stability and link quality. In order to prevent the generation of serious noisy nodes and frequency hopping data, the interference nodes under the intrusion of the Internet of Things are identified by determining transition amplitude of the noise nodes in the transmission data sequence. Finally, according to the calculation results of the optimal communication node selection, the design of the intelligent spacing selection model for the communication nodes of the Internet of Things is realized. The simulation results show that the established model not only reduces energy consumption of nodes, shortens the average transmission delay of nodes, but also improves anti-interference effect of node spacing selection.

The Internet of Things is a concept of a computer network of physical objects (“things”) equipped with built-in technologies for interaction with each other or with the external environment, considering the organization of such networks as a phenomenon capable of restructuring economic and social processes, excluding the need for human actions and operations. The Internet of things consists of loosely connected disparate networks, each of which is deployed to solve specific tasks. For example, in modern cars there are multiple networks for controling the operation of the engine and other systems, for supporting third communications, etc. The offices and residential buildings are also equipped with many networks for controlling heating, ventilation, air-conditioning, telephone, security, lighting. As the Internet of things evolves, these and many other networks will be connected to each other and gain a higher level of security. As a result, the Internet of things will gain even more opportunities to open up new, broader perspectives for humanity. This article is devoted to the popular concept the Internet of things. The author analyzes the opportunities, as well as vulnerabilities of this phenomenon. It has benn suggested that the use of Internet Protocol of version 6 will solve many problems of this concept including those related to security.

With the expansion of social energy use, the optimization of residential energy conservation has become urgent and important. The research on rural housing in areas with hot summers and cold winters started late and is relatively backward in terms of housing energy saving, which greatly hinders the sustainable development of rural areas. The application of the Internet of Things technology helps to provide a stable technical guarantee for energy-saving optimization. Therefore, this paper takes the energy-saving optimization design of rural houses in hot summer and cold winter areas based on the Internet of Things technology as the research theme. This article first takes H rural area as the research object and analyzes the climatic conditions of the place, that is, the typical characteristics of hot summer and cold winter. Then, the intelligent temperature acquisition system is designed, and the working process and main hardware modules of the system are introduced. This text combines GPRS and Internet of Things technology, designs the temperature control system, and carries on the test to the system operation effect. The test results show that during the heating period in January, before and after the temperature control system controls the room temperature, the maximum relative error between the set temperature value and the actual temperature value is 0.49 and 0.27, respectively. It can be seen that the intelligent temperature energy-saving control system can collect the indoor temperature in real time and can well control the heating equipment.

This research's research problem is how to solve problems using office electronic equipment to make it more efficient by using internet technology as a medium for controlling air conditioning, computers, and lights. Sometimes we still find a room with electronic equipment such as air conditioning, computers, and lights that are always on even though they are not used, so it seems wasteful and inefficient. Therefore we need an Internet of Things-based smart office system that can regulate and control conditions. office electronic equipment from anywhere via the internet network can help identify and monitor whether it is on or off. The control system is expected to help place and watch remote electronic device turns on and off via a user interface. This research aims to design a smart office system based on the internet of things so that it can be used to identify and control office electronic equipment flexibly. This study resulted in a prototype of a smart office system based on the internet of things that can help identify and maintain electronic equipment in the office.
